South Salisbury Avenue, Spencer on the map

Home > States > North Carolina > Spencer > South Salisbury Avenue

Spencer, South Salisbury Avenue. Online map.

South Salisbury Avenueon the interactive online map Spencer. Spencer, South Salisbury Avenue. Search on the map, closest way, distance to the South Salisbury Avenue. Simple and easy to use on mobile devices.